Job Description
Engineering Lead, Platform Engineering
Koalafi
• Manage a team of engineers with full accountability for their performance, growth, and wellbeing • Own 1:1s, performance reviews, and career development conversations — providing direct, constructive feedback that helps engineers grow • Build a team culture that is organized, reliable, and focused on impact • Mentor engineers through code reviews, pairing, and delivery coaching • Be a strong technical contributor: carry significant engineering weight alongside the team and actively deliver on high-impact work • Translate architectural direction into sprint-level tasks the team can act on • Build and evolve CI/CD pipelines and delivery automation: ensuring deployment safety, consistency, and velocity • Improve observability and operational readiness across metrics, logging, distributed tracing, and alerting — including actionable dashboards and SLO-based alerting • Design and implement automation and self-service workflows using infrastructure-as-code, APIs, and developer platforms to reduce developer friction • Own incident response coordination: drive the process, communicate status, and ensure issues reach the right people • Participate in the on-call rotation and help drive improvements that reduce incidents and alert noise over time • Build and maintain operational runbooks, escalation paths, and documentation for team-owned systems • Drive production readiness as a continuous standard, not a one-time checklist
Job Requirements
- 7+ years of hands-on experience in cloud infrastructure/platform engineering with demonstrated scope growth and increasing leadership responsibility over that time
- Strong hands-on experience with Terraform in production (modules, patterns, environment strategy, state management)
- Strong hands-on experience operating Kubernetes in production
- Strong AWS fundamentals: practical experience with compute, networking, IAM, and production operations
- Experience building and maintaining CI/CD pipelines
- Strong observability fundamentals including metrics, logging, distributed tracing, SLO/SLI design, and alerting strategy
- Experience building automation using Bash and at least one general-purpose language (Python or Go)
- Strong troubleshooting skills: you drive root cause analysis and implement long-term fixes, not workarounds
- Hands-on experience using AI coding tools (e.g., GitHub Copilot, Cursor, Claude) as a productivity multiplier in production engineering work
- Comfort partnering with senior technical peers and sound judgment on when to consult vs. decide independently.
